Mikla Restaurant
Mikla Restaurant is the first influential step in the Turkish restaurant industry with the famous chef Mehmet Gurs. It attracts attention not only with its star-worthy service but also with its innovative structure. You can enjoy delicious plates while admiring the most beautiful view of the city. Tersane Ocakbasi
Tersane Ocakbaşı offers an authentic Turkish grill experience in a lively yet refined setting. Known for its high-quality meats cooked over traditional charcoal fire, the restaurant combines classic ocakbaşı culture with attentive service and a stylish atmosphere. A rich selection of mezes accompanies the perfectly grilled kebabs, creating a well-rounded and satisfying dining experience. Reservations are recommended, especially during peak hours.

Pandeli Restaurant
Located above the historic Spice Bazaar, Pandeli Restaurant is one of Istanbul’s most iconic culinary landmarks. Serving guests since the early 20th century, it is renowned for its classic Ottoman and traditional Turkish dishes prepared with time-honored recipes.
The restaurant’s distinctive blue-tiled interior and nostalgic atmosphere create an elegant setting that reflects the city’s rich gastronomic heritage.
